The theory behind acupuncture for beauty concerns

Acupuncture for the skin is based on the same principles as acupuncture for aches and illnesses.

Shellie Goldstein, a New York-based acupuncturist, told Vogue, “We look at your internal well-being to decipher what’s going on. From the inside, we will make that change, and it will be reflected on the outside.”

This change is done by inserting fine, sterile needles into specific points on your body. Each resulting “micro-trauma,” as Goldstein calls it, leads to a healing response. In short, acupuncture treats underlying disharmonies within your body, thus addressing your beauty problems.

Here are five ways that acupuncture can help you resolve your beauty issues:

1. Say goodbye to a swollen face

Ever woke up in the morning to find a puffy face? Acupuncture may be the beauty solution you’ve been looking for.

TCM practitioners believe that a puffy face is a symptom of digestive problems, allergies, or poor lymphatic drainage, which can be improved with acupuncture. Acupuncture will stimulate a healing response in the respective body system, addressing the root cause for the puffiness.

2. Brighten up your dull complexion

Acupuncture can raise your energy level and stimulate blood circulation, lymphatic drainage, and collagen production to bring out the radiance from your flat complexion. Acupuncture needles and massages are used to give you that lit-from-within glow.

3. Get rid of acne

Hormonal fluctuations and internal heat can cause acne. Acupuncture can help to rebalance the body and clear up your acne. “We look at acne as a reflection of internal heat, and the digestive system,” Goldstein explains to Vogue. “We can adjust premenstrual breakouts through acupuncture as well by treating the heat that arises” in the body at certain times of the month.

You can also treat other skin issues such as rosacea, eczema, wrinkles, and sagging by acupuncture.

4. Stimulate hair growth

This may be relevant to you if you suffer from hair loss or hair thinning. According to TCM, these issues may result from disrupted blood or energy flow to the scalp. Apart from improving blood circulation and energy distribution, acupuncture can stimulate your hair follicles to help with these hair issues.

5. Lose weight

There are a variety of reasons for weight gain, and acupuncture seeks out the specific cause to help you lose weight effectively. Generally, the treatment brings balance back to your spleen and liver systems. In addition, other parts of your body may be treated. Your endocrine system and kidneys, which can cause water retention issues, may be targeted.

Alternatively, your spleen and thyroid gland may be targeted to rebalance your sugar and hormonal levels. If your weight gain is due to premenstrual syndrome (aka PMS) or menopause, the treatment may target your adrenal and ovary glands too.
